I have a Dataset padded with -500 so the row length of the matrix stays the same. Now I want to extract an array from a row containing only the values that aren't -500.
e.g
A = [2,1,2,3,4,-500,-500,-500 ; 2,3,4,5,-500,-500,-500,-500]
i've tried this but it gives me only the boolean answer
A1 = A(1,:) > -500 -> A1 = [1,1,1,1,1,0,0,0]
what i want would be A1 = [2,1,2,3,4]

You can use the logical vector to index the main array i.e
A(A1)

Better yet, combine them into 1 line,
A1 = A(1,A(1,:)~=-500)
